
No Churn Dairy Free Matcha Ice Cream
This dairy free matcha ice cream is made with coconut milk and is such a luscious and refreshing treat! It only takes 5 ingredients, and no ice cream maker required! If you're a matcha lover, this ice cream is perfect for you.

Ingredients
- 13 ½ ounces - Coconut Cream full fat coconut milk
- ⅔ cup - Sweetened Condensed Coconut Milk
- 4 teaspoons - Matcha Green Tea Powder
- 5 tablespoons - Hot Water
- 2 teaspoons - Vanilla Extract
Instructions
- Make sure to place the cans of coconut milk in the fridge the day before making this recipe. When ready to make, scoop the thick cream off the top of the cans, without tipping, and add the coconut cream to a large mixing bowl. Save the remaining coconut water for another use.
- In a small bowl, whisk together matcha powder and hot water. Add matcha mixture and all other ingredients to the mixing bowl.
- Use a hand mixer to mix on medium speed for 5 minutes or until considerably thickened. Pour into a container or loaf pan. Cover and place in the freezer for at least 4 hours or until firm.
- Let defrost for 10-15 minutes and enjoy!
